Help! Need Information on Scholarships for College in the Philippines

I'm a high school junior planning to attend college in the Philippines, and I'm eager to learn about scholarship opportunities. What are some good places to find scholarships there? Any specific ones to look out for?

a year ago

The scholarship search for students planning to study in the Philippines can be varied and fruitful. There are scholarships particular to the country itself, as well as those tailored towards international students.

One place to begin your search is with the Commission on Higher Education (CHED) in the Philippines. CHED offers multiple scholarships for deserving students, and these can be a great starting point for your search. Check out their Student Financial Assistance Programs (StuFAPs) -- they offer both full and partial scholarships based on both financial need and academic merit.

Many universities in the Philippines also offer their own scholarships. The University of the Philippines, for example, provides a number of scholarships and financial aid options to both local and international students. Ateneo de Manila University also offers scholarship programs, including the Athletic Scholarship and the Ateneo Freshman Merit Scholarship, along with need-based tuition discounts.

Another resource is Edukasyon.ph's scholarship database, which includes numerous scholarship opportunities for students interested in attending school in the Philippines.

Lastly, you might want to approach organizations that have an international focus. Rotary International, for example, has previously offered a number of scholarships for students studying abroad.

Remember to carefully read the eligibility criteria and application process for each scholarship. Also, keep an eye on deadlines to ensure you apply on time. Start researching and applying as early as possible, as some scholarships might have an application deadline well in advance of the school year. Good luck!
